What You'll Do:

  • Provide customer service to students, staff, visitors, and/or faculty by carrying out security-related procedures, site-specific policies, and when appropriate, emergency response activities at an education location.
  • Respond to incidents, disturbances, and/or critical situations in a calm, problem-solving manner, documenting observations and reporting concerns according to site protocols.
  • Conduct regular and random patrols throughout campus buildings, parking areas, walkways, and perimeter locations to help to deter unauthorized activity and identify unusual conditions.
  • Monitor access points and activity across the location, offering directions and assistance while helping to support a professional environment for daily operations and scheduled events.
  • Communicate with site contacts, emergency personnel, and/or Allied Universal leadership regarding incidents, policy questions, and changing conditions that may require attention.
